*Pearson is looking for Teachers of the Visually Impaired to participate in
a study!*



The study is looking at the accessibility and usability of a digital math
equation editor that Pearson is designing.  If you are a certified teacher
of the visually impaired:

   - who is competent in Nemeth Code


   - who is certified to teach Algebra I or above, Chemistry, or Physics


   - or you are not certified in these courses, but you support students
   who take these courses

... then please consider participating in this important work.  The
honorarium for about 75 minutes of your time will be a $150 Visa gift card.
